Introducción a la comparación entre Cursor y VS Code
El profesor Patterns introduce una comparación entre dos poderosas herramientas de codificación: VS Code y Cursor. El objetivo es explorar si Cursor puede ser una alternativa viable a VS Code, especialmente para aquellos que utilizan asistentes con IA como Klein.
Impresiones iniciales de Cursor
Interfaz inicial de Cursor
Cursor se presenta como una interfaz de codificación similar a VS Code pero con características mejoradas como autocompletado avanzado y un flujo de trabajo basado en agentes.
Demostración de generación de código con VS Code y Cursor
El profesor Patterns demuestra cómo tanto VS Code como Cursor pueden generar un juego de Flappy Bird en JavaScript con física básica. Se observa la diferencia en velocidad, calidad y facilidad de uso.
Experiencia de codificación inicial con Cursor
El profesor explora la interfaz de Cursor, creando un nuevo archivo y utilizando sus capacidades de autocompletado, que se nota que son extensas y similares a las de VS Code.
Análisis de costos: VS Code con Klein vs. Cursor
Se realiza un análisis de costos, comparando los gastos de usar VS Code con los cargos de la API de Klein versus el modelo de precios basado en suscripción de Cursor. El costo de generar código con VS Code se nota que es de aproximadamente $0.17, y se discuten la estética y la funcionalidad de la interfaz.
Mejorando la interfaz
Se discuten los esfuerzos para mejorar la interfaz y la funcionalidad del código generado, con el profesor que busca hacer que la interfaz sea más atractiva y fácil de usar.
Comparación de rendimiento continuada
Se compara el rendimiento de ambas herramientas en el manejo de mejoras al código generado, incluyendo mejoras estéticas y ajustes de funcionalidad.
Desglose de precios de Cursor
Se detalla el modelo de precios de Cursor, con la versión profesional costando alrededor de $16 por mes. Esto incluye completaciones ilimitadas y acceso a modelos de IA de nivel superior como GPT-4.
Conclusión
La conclusión resume los puntos principales de comparación entre VS Code y Cursor, destacando las compensaciones entre costo, funcionalidad y facilidad de uso. La decisión entre las dos herramientas ultimately depende de las necesidades específicas del desarrollador, incluyendo el tamaño del proyecto y el nivel de integración de IA deseado.
La decisión final sobre si usar VS Code con Klein o Cursor depende de varios factores, incluyendo el tamaño del proyecto, la necesidad de funciones de IA avanzadas y consideraciones de presupuesto. Para los desarrolladores que trabajan en proyectos más pequeños o requieren menos asistencia de IA, VS Code con Klein podría ser más rentable. Sin embargo, para aquellos que participan en proyectos más grandes o necesitan un apoyo de IA extenso, el modelo de suscripción de Cursor, a pesar de su tarifa mensual, podría ofrecer un mejor valor debido a sus completaciones ilimitadas y acceso a modelos de IA de nivel superior.